Investing.com – U.K. stocks were lower after the close on Tuesday, as losses in the Construction & Materials, Food & Drug Retailers and Life Insurance/Assurance sectors led shares lower.
At the close in London, the Investing.com United Kingdom 100 fell 0.26% to hit a new 1-month low.
The best performers of the session on the Investing.com United Kingdom 100 were Fresnillo PLC (LON:FRES), which rose 2.76% or 39.00 points to trade at 1453.00 at the close. Meanwhile, Antofagasta PLC (LON:ANTO) added 2.58% or 21.00 points to end at 835.00 and London Stock Exchange Group PLC (LON:LSE) was up 2.03% or 63.00 points to 3171.00 in late trade.
The worst performers of the session were Legal & General Group PLC (LON:LGEN), which fell 2.04% or 4.900 points to trade at 234.900 at the close. Carnival PLC (LON:CCL) declined 1.99% or 86.00 points to end at 4238.00 and Associated British Foods PLC (LON:ABF) was down 1.85% or 45.00 points to 2386.00.
Falling stocks outnumbered advancing ones on the London Stock Exchange by 1083 to 884 and 409 ended unchanged.
Shares in London Stock Exchange Group PLC (LON:LSE) rose to all time highs; rising 2.03% or 63.00 to 3171.00.
Gold Futures for April delivery was up 1.43% or 17.15 to $1213.15 a troy ounce. Elsewhere in commodities trading, Crude oil for delivery in March rose 1.50% or 0.79 to hit $53.42 a barrel, while the April Brent oil contract rose 1.70% or 0.94 to trade at $56.26 a barrel.
GBP/USD was up 0.78% to 1.2584, while EUR/GBP rose 0.14% to 0.8576.
The US Dollar Index Futures was down 0.84% at 99.58.
